+/dts-v1/;
+
+/ {
+	model = "AXM5516";
+	compatible = "arm", "lsi,axm5516";
+	interrupt-parent = <&gic>;
+	#address-cells = <2>;
+	#size-cells = <2>;
+
+	chosen { };
+
+	aliases {
+		serial0   = &axxia_serial0;
+		timer     = &axxia_timers;
+		ethernet0 = &axxia_femac0;
+	};
+
+	cpus {
+		#address-cells = <1>;
+		#size-cells = <0>;
+
+		cpu at 0 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<0>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+
+		cpu at 1 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<1>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+
+		cpu at 2 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<2>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+
+		cpu at 3 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<3>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+
+		/*
+		cpu at 4 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<4>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+
+		cpu at 5 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<5>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+
+		cpu at 6 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"arm,cortex-a15";
+			reg = <6>;
+                        cpu-release-addr = <0>; // Fixed by the boot loader
+		};
+		*/
+	};
+
+	memory at 00000000 {
+		device_type = "memory";
+		reg = <0 0x00000000 0 0x10000000>;
+	};
+
+	gic: interrupt-controller at 2001001000 {
+		compatible = "arm,cortex-a15-gic", "arm,cortex-a9-gic";
+		#interrupt-cells = <3>;
+		#address-cells = <0>;
+		interrupt-controller;
+		reg = <0x20 0x01001000 0 0x1000>,  /* gic dist base */
+		      <0x20 0x01002000 0 0x100>,   /* gic cpu base */
+		      <0x20 0x10030000 0 0x100>,   /* axm IPI mask reg base */
+		      <0x20 0x10040000 0 0x20000>; /* axm IPI send reg base */
+	};
+
+	timer {
+		compatible = "arm,armv7-timer";
+		interrupts = <1 13 0xf08>,
+			     <1 14 0xf08>;
+	};
+
+
+	gpdma at 2020140000 {
+		compatible = "lsi,dma32";
+		reg = <0x20 0x20140000 0x00 0x1000>;
+		interrupts = <0 60 4>, /* busy */
+			     <0 61 4>; /* error */
+
+		channel0 {
+			interrupts = <0 62 4>;
+		};
+
+		channel1 {
+			interrupts = <0 63 4>;
+		};
+	};
+
+	gpdma at 2020141000 {
+		status = "disabled";
+		compatible = "lsi,dma32";
+		reg = <0x20 0x20141000 0x00 0x1000>;
+		interrupts = <0 64 4>, /* busy */
+			     <0 65 4>; /* error */
+
+		channel0 {
+			interrupts = <0 66 4>;
+		};
+
+		channel1 {
+			interrupts = <0 67 4>;
+		};
+	};
+
+	gpreg at 2010094000  {
+		compatible = "lsi,gpreg";
+		reg = <0x20 0x10094000 0 0x1000>;
+	};
+
+        axxia_femac0: femac at 0x2010120000 {
+                compatible = "acp-femac";
+		device_type = "network";
+		reg = <0x20 0x10120000 0 0x1000>,
+   		      <0x20 0x10121000 0 0x1000>,
+		      <0x20 0x10122000 0 0x1000>;
+		interrupts = <0 2 4>,
+		             <0 3 4>,
+		             <0 4 4>;
+		mdio-reg = <0x20 0x10090000 0 0x1000>;
+		mdio-clock = <0>;
+		phy-address = <0x3>;
+		ad-value = <0x61>;
+		mac-address = [00 00 00 00 00 00];
+	};
+
+        amba {
+		compatible = "arm,amba-bus";
+		#address-cells = <2>;
+		#size-cells = <2>;
+		ranges;
+
+		axxia_serial0: uart at 2010080000 {
+			compatible = "arm,pl011", "arm,primecell";
+			reg = <0x20 0x10080000 0x00 0x1000>;
+			interrupts = <0 56 4>;
+		};
+
+		axxia_timers: timer at 2010091000 {
+			compatible = "arm,sp804", "arm,primecell";
+			reg = <0x20 0x10091000 0 0x1000>;
+			interrupts = <0 46 4>,
+				     <0 47 4>,
+				     <0 48 4>,
+				     <0 49 4>,
+				     <0 50 4>,
+				     <0 51 4>,
+				     <0 52 4>,
+				     <0 53 4>;
+		};
+	};
+};
